Where is the Sawyers family from?
You can see how Sawyers families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Sawyers family name was found in the USA, the UK, Canada, and Scotland between 1840 and 1920. The most Sawyers families were found in USA in 1880. In 1911 there were 61 Sawyers families living in Ontario. This was about 80% of all the recorded Sawyers's in Canada. Ontario had the highest population of Sawyers families in 1911.

In 1921, Farmer and Couturire were the top reported jobs for men and women in the Canada named Sawyers. 50% of Sawyers men worked as a Farmer and 100% of Sawyers women worked as a Couturire. .
Between 1944 and 2004, in the United States, Sawyers life expectancy was at its lowest point in 1944, and highest in 1962. The average life expectancy for Sawyers in 1944 was 27, and 69 in 2004.
